You can also click the Start menu and select "Run". … WebOpen your world in MCA Selector Click on "Tools" -> "Filter chunks" Replace the line xPos <= 100 AND xPos >= -100 AND zPos <= 100 AND zPos >= -100 with InhabitedTime = "0", press Enter then click "OK" Now the generated chunks that no player has ever been near are selected. You can delete them by hover at "Selection" -> Delete selected chunks -> OK
